The process of creating lab-grown diamonds involves advanced technology that replicates the natural conditions under which diamonds form, resulting in gems that are virtually indistinguishable from their mined counterparts.The creation of lab-grown diamonds takes place through two primary methods: High Pressure High Temperature (HPHT) and Chemical Vapor Deposition (CVD).
In the HPHT process, carbon is subjected to extreme pressure and temperature, mimicking the earth’s natural processes. Alternatively, the CVD method involves using a gas mixture that allows carbon atoms to crystallize on a substrate, forming a diamond layer. Both methods yield diamonds that are chemically and physically identical to natural diamonds, ensuring their brilliance and durability.

Benefits of Choosing Lab Grown Diamonds
Choosing lab-grown diamonds presents numerous advantages over their natural counterparts. These benefits make them an attractive option for consumers seeking value and ethical considerations in their jewelry purchases. The significant advantages include:
- Cost-Effectiveness: Lab-grown diamonds often cost 20-40% less than mined diamonds, allowing consumers to invest in larger or higher-quality stones without breaking the bank.
- Ethical Considerations: Lab-grown diamonds eliminate concerns about conflict diamonds and unethical mining practices, promoting a more responsible jewelry industry.
- Environmental Impact: The production of lab-grown diamonds generally has a smaller environmental footprint compared to traditional diamond mining, which can cause significant ecological disruption.
- Availability: Lab-grown diamonds are more readily available, ensuring a consistent supply that isn’t affected by mining regulations or market fluctuations.
Comparison of Lab Grown Diamonds and Mined Diamonds
When comparing lab-grown diamonds to mined diamonds, it’s essential to consider several characteristics that differentiate them. While both types of diamonds possess the same physical and chemical properties, certain distinctions do exist. The main comparison points include:
- Origin: Lab-grown diamonds are created in controlled environments, whereas mined diamonds are formed over billions of years deep within the Earth’s crust.
- Certification: Both types can be certified by gemological labs, but lab-grown diamonds are often accompanied by different grading reports that indicate their synthetic origin.
- Resale Value: Mined diamonds typically hold their value better than lab-grown diamonds, which may have a lower resale price due to market perception.
- Visual Appearance: Both types of diamonds can have similar attributes, such as cut, color, clarity, and carat weight. However, lab-grown diamonds can be tailored for specific qualities during production.

Whether you’re dressing up for a formal event or adding a touch of sparkle to your everyday look, 1.5 carat earrings are versatile and stunning.The visual impact of a 1.5 carat lab-grown diamond is remarkable.
These diamonds typically measure around 7.4 mm in diameter, which allows them to catch light beautifully and create a dazzling display of brilliance and fire. The combination of size and the exceptional quality of lab-grown diamonds results in an eye-catching accessory that commands attention without being overwhelming.
Popular Styles and Settings for 1.5 Carat Earrings, Lab grown diamond earrings 1.5 carat
When it comes to 1.5 carat lab-grown diamond earrings, there are several styles and settings that are particularly favored, each offering a unique aesthetic. The following are some popular choices that enhance the beauty and appeal of these earrings:
- Stud Earrings: A classic choice, stud earrings feature a single diamond set directly onto the earlobe, providing a timeless and elegant look that works for both casual and formal attire.
- Halo Settings: These settings surround the central diamond with smaller diamonds, creating a stunning halo effect that enhances the overall sparkle and appearance, making the diamond appear larger and more radiant.
- Drop Earrings: Adding movement to your look, drop earrings feature a diamond that hangs below the earlobe, often in a linear or chandelier style. This design adds drama and sophistication to any outfit.
- Leverback Earrings: Offering both style and security, these earrings use a hinged lever to keep them securely in place while showcasing the diamond in a way that allows for maximum light exposure.
Each of these styles can be customized with different metal settings, including platinum, white gold, yellow gold, or rose gold, allowing wearers to choose a combination that best reflects their personal style and preferences.

Evaluating Quality of Lab-Grown Diamonds
Understanding how to assess the quality of lab-grown diamonds is crucial for ensuring you make the right selection. Here are some tips to help you evaluate their quality effectively:
- Inspect the Cut: The cut determines the brilliance of the diamond. Ideal cuts will showcase the diamond’s sparkle and light performance, so prioritize well-cut stones.
- Check the Color Grade: Lab-grown diamonds typically exhibit a range of colors. Aim for diamonds in the G-H range for a perfect balance between value and visual appeal.
- Examine Clarity: Look for diamonds with fewer inclusions. Clarity grades ranging from VS1 to SI2 are often ideal, as they tend to be eye-clean and affordable.

Proper Cleaning Methods for Lab Grown Diamond Earrings
To keep your lab-grown diamond earrings shining bright, regular cleaning is necessary. Dust, oils, and other residues can accumulate over time, dulling their sparkle. Here are effective methods for cleaning your earrings:
- Use a soft, lint-free cloth to gently wipe the diamonds and metal settings, removing surface dirt and oils.
- Create a cleaning solution using warm water and a few drops of mild dish soap. Soak your earrings in this solution for about 15-20 minutes.
- Gently brush the earrings with a soft-bristled toothbrush, paying special attention to the areas around the stones where grime can build up.
- Rinse thoroughly under warm water, ensuring no soap residue remains, and dry with a soft cloth.
Regular cleaning prevents buildup and maintains the brilliance of your lab-grown diamonds.

Best Practices for Storing and Protecting Diamond Earrings
Proper storage is crucial for protecting your lab-grown diamond earrings from damage. Here are some best practices to follow:
- Store earrings in a soft-lined jewelry box or pouch to prevent scratches and tangling.
- Avoid storing them with other jewelry pieces that may scratch their surfaces; consider individual compartments.
- Keep earrings away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ures, which can affect the materials and settings.
- If traveling, pack your earrings in a secure case to minimize movement and protect them from impacts.
Proper storage not only protects your jewelry but also prolongs its lifespan.
When to Seek Professional Maintenance or Inspection
Even with diligent care, there are times when professional maintenance is necessary. Regular inspections can help in identifying any issues before they become significant problems. Consider these guidelines for professional care:
- Schedule an inspection at least once a year to check for loose stones and worn settings.
- If you notice any scratches or damage to the metal, a jeweler can polish and restore the finish.
- Seek professional cleaning once in a while, especially if your earrings have not been cleaned for an extended period.
- If your earrings have intricate designs or multiple stones, professional assessment ensures they are maintained correctly.
Timely professional care can prevent costly repairs and preserve the quality of your earrings.
